Abstract

To provide a safety helmet which can be folded compactly.SOLUTION: There is provided a safety helmet 1 including a crown 2 formed by a semi-cylindrical peripheral surface portion 4 and end faces 6 connected to both ends of a peripheral surface portion in a cylinder axis direction via a ridge line portion, in which the peripheral surface portion is formed by an upper quadrangular panel 7 and a lower quadrangular panel 8, each of the end faces is formed by an upper tapered panel and a lower tapered panel 10, each of the upper tapered panel 9 and the lower tapered panel tapers radially inwardly, the ridge line portion passing between the upper quadrangular panels and between the pair of upper tapered panels on each of the end faces constitutes a valley-foldable ridge line portion 11, a ridge line portion passing between the upper rectangular panel and the lower rectangular panel and between the upper tapered panel and the lower tapered panel in each of the end faces constitutes a mountain-foldable ridge line portion 12, each of the upper quadrangular panel, the lower quadrangular panel, the upper tapered panel, and the lower tapered panel has a cushioning material, and the ridge line portion does not have the cushioning material.SELECTED DRAWING: Figure 1

以下、図面を参照しつつ本発明の実施形態を例示説明する。 Embodiments of the present invention will be exemplified below with reference to the drawings.

図1~図3に示すように、本発明の一実施形態において安全帽1は、頭部に被ることで、外部からの頭部への衝撃を緩衝し、傷害の発生を抑制することができる。つまり、安全帽1は例えば、簡易ヘルメット、軽作業用帽子又は防災用帽子などとして使用できる。 As shown in FIGS. 1 to 3, in one embodiment of the present invention, a safety helmet 1 is worn on the head to absorb external impacts on the head and suppress the occurrence of injuries. . That is, the safety helmet 1 can be used, for example, as a simple helmet, a hat for light work, a hat for disaster prevention, or the like.

安全帽1はクラウン2とツバ3を有する。クラウン2は、半筒状の周面部4と、周面部4の筒軸方向の両端に稜線部(以下、端部稜線部5ともいう)を介して連なる一対の端面部6とで形成される。なお本願において、半筒状の周面部4についての筒軸方向、径方向及び周方向を、単に筒軸方向、径方向及び周方向ともいう。 A safety helmet 1 has a crown 2 and a brim 3. The crown 2 is formed of a semi-cylindrical peripheral surface portion 4 and a pair of end surface portions 6 that are connected to both ends of the peripheral surface portion 4 in the cylinder axis direction via ridgeline portions (hereinafter also referred to as end ridgeline portions 5). . In the present application, the axial direction, the radial direction, and the circumferential direction of the semi-cylindrical peripheral surface portion 4 are also simply referred to as the axial direction, the radial direction, and the circumferential direction.

周面部4は、一対の上側四角形状パネル7と一対の下側四角形状パネル8とで形成される。端面部6の各々は、一対の上側先細状パネル9と一対の下側先細状パネル10とで形成される。上側先細状パネル9と下側先細状パネル10の各々は、径方向の内側に向けて先細状をなす。 The peripheral surface 4 is formed by a pair of upper square panels 7 and a pair of lower square panels 8 . Each of the end faces 6 is formed by a pair of upper tapered panels 9 and a pair of lower tapered panels 10 . Each of the upper tapered panel 9 and the lower tapered panel 10 tapers radially inwardly.

一対の上側四角形状パネル7の間と、端面部6の各々における一対の上側先細状パネル9の間と、を通る稜線部は、図4に示すように谷折り可能な谷折り稜線部11を構成する。 The ridgeline portion passing between the pair of upper rectangular panels 7 and between the pair of upper tapered panels 9 on each of the end faces 6 forms a valley-fold ridgeline portion 11 that can be valley-folded as shown in FIG. Configure.

谷折り稜線部11の周方向の両側の各々において、上側四角形状パネル7と下側四角形状パネル8の間と、端面部6の各々における上側先細状パネル9と下側先細状パネル10の間と、を通る稜線部は、図4に示すように山折り可能な山折り稜線部12を構成する。 Between the upper rectangular panel 7 and the lower rectangular panel 8 on each of the circumferential sides of the valley fold ridge 11, and between the upper tapered panel 9 and the lower tapered panel 10 on each of the end faces 6. , constitutes a mountain-folded ridge-line portion 12 capable of mountain-folding as shown in FIG.

端面部6の各々において、一対の下側先細状パネル10の先端縁の間を稜線部(以下、先端稜線部13ともいう)が上下方向に通る。 In each of the end face portions 6 , a ridgeline portion (hereinafter also referred to as a tip ridgeline portion 13 ) passes vertically between the tip edges of the pair of lower tapered panels 10 .

上側四角形状パネル7、下側四角形状パネル8、上側先細状パネル9及び下側先細状パネル10の各々は、緩衝材14を有し、より具体的には表地15、緩衝材14及び裏地16をこの順に有する(図2参照)。緩衝材14の材質は特に限定されず、例えば発泡樹脂などで構成される。表地15と裏地16の材質は特に限定されず、例えば布、不織布、メッシュ材などで構成される。 Each of the upper square panel 7, lower square panel 8, upper tapered panel 9 and lower tapered panel 10 has a cushioning material 14, more specifically an outer material 15, a cushioning material 14 and a lining material 16. in this order (see FIG. 2). The material of the cushioning material 14 is not particularly limited, and may be made of, for example, foamed resin. The material of the outer material 15 and the lining material 16 is not particularly limited, and is composed of, for example, cloth, non-woven fabric, mesh material, or the like.

上側四角形状パネル7の各々は、稜線部(以下、中間稜線部17ともいう)を介して連なる一対の四角形状パネル18で形成される(図1参照)。 Each of the upper quadrangular panels 7 is formed of a pair of quadrangular panels 18 connected via a ridgeline portion (hereinafter also referred to as an intermediate ridgeline portion 17) (see FIG. 1).

稜線部の各々は、緩衝材14を有さない。つまり、端部稜線部5、谷折り稜線部11、山折り稜線部12、先端稜線部13及び中間稜線部17の各々は、緩衝材14を有さず、より具体的には、表地15と裏地16が緩衝材14を介さずに互いに固着される(図2参照)。固着の方法は特に限定されず、例えば縫合である。 Each of the ridges does not have cushioning material 14 . That is, each of the end ridgeline 5, the valley-fold ridgeline 11, the mountain-fold ridgeline 12, the tip ridgeline 13, and the intermediate ridgeline 17 does not have the cushioning material 14. The linings 16 are adhered to each other without the cushioning material 14 (see FIG. 2). The method of fixation is not particularly limited, and is suture, for example.

ツバ3は、一対の下側四角形状パネル8の一方に対応して設けられる(図1参照)。 The brim 3 is provided corresponding to one of the pair of lower quadrangular panels 8 (see FIG. 1).

本実施形態によれば、安全帽1を、図1に示すような頭に被せることが可能な展開状態から、太線矢印で示すように谷折り稜線部11を径方向内側に押し込むことにより、一対の下側四角形状パネル8同士が白抜き矢印で示すように接近するようにクラウン2を変形させながら、谷折り稜線部11を谷折り状態とするとともに一対の山折り稜線部12の各々を山折り状態とし、その結果、図4に示すようなコンパクトに畳まれた折り畳み状態にすることができる。 According to this embodiment, the safety helmet 1 can be put on the head as shown in FIG. While deforming the crown 2 so that the lower quadrangular panels 8 approach each other as indicated by the white arrows, the valley-folded ridgeline portion 11 is brought into the valley-folded state, and each of the pair of mountain-folded ridgeline portions 12 is folded into a mountain. As a result, a compact folded state as shown in FIG. 4 can be obtained.

また、本実施形態によれば、端面部6の各々が先端稜線部13を有するので、端面部6の各々において一対の下側先細状パネル10の先端付近に緩衝材14を密に配置することができ、その結果、安全性を高めることができる。 Further, according to the present embodiment, each of the end face portions 6 has the tip ridge line portion 13, so that the cushioning material 14 can be densely arranged near the tip ends of the pair of lower tapered panels 10 on each of the end face portions 6. and, as a result, increased safety.
